Output 237eec3cc4c131f2f2a59626a625ed2f73f88a004bc8c858db2d5bad42d2140b:69

value
68503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c56ec01ee9306e85a6f5eb08cf68bf3b7e893b3 OP_EQUALVERIFY OP_CHECKSIG
address
153Srt4Tvon6ZSENUUSFVEHfDbLx2aqCfn
transaction
237eec3cc4c131f2f2a59626a625ed2f73f88a004bc8c858db2d5bad42d2140b
spent
true